Known For
Acting
The Nanny
Stage Actor
1993
Hang Time
1995
Like Father, Like Santa
Whoops
1998
Inhabited
The Huldre (King)
2003
Bad Chemistry
Jonathan
Lucid
2021
Ego Death
Gale